1. A medical device wearable by a subject, the device comprising:

  • an implantable component having a housing and a first antenna coupled to the housing, wherein at least one of the housing or the first antenna is made of a flexible material such that the housing and the first antenna follow a curvature of a skull of the subject when implanted between the skull and a scalp of the subject, wherein the implantable component measures EEG signals representing brain activity;

    an external second antenna, the second antenna having a loop portion sized to fit over a head of the subject; and

    an external control module configured to interact with the implantable component via the external second antenna and receive and process the EEG signals from the implantable component.
